What is the CA dashboard?
The California School Dashboard (Dashboard) is an online tool that shows how local educational agencies and schools are performing on the state and local indicators included in California’s school accountability system. The Dashboard provides information that schools can use to improve.

What is DataQuest CDE?
DataQuest is an online data reporting resource that provides access to a wide variety of data reports and downloadable data files. DataQuest is the California Department of Education’s web-based data reporting system for publicly reporting information about California students, teachers, and schools.
What do the colors mean on the CA dashboard?
There are five performance levels, and each is assigned a different color: Red is the lowest performance level, Orange is the second lowest, Yellow is the middle point, Green is the second highest, and Blue is the highest performance level.
What are local indicators?
The Local Indicators are indicators based on the Eight State Priorities included in a Local Education Agency’s (LEA’s) Local Control and Accountability Plan (LCAP). Unlike the state measures that are automatically calculated by state-captured data, the Local Indicators are calculated with data collected by each LEA.

What percentage of public school students are black?
This statistic shows the percentage or share of students enrolled in U.S. public schools in different states around the U.S. in fall 2018, by students’ race or ethnicity. In California in 2018, 22.9 percent of students were White, 5.4 percent were Black and 54.6 percent were Hispanic.
